For many years, Semler has focused on food waste recycling. What started as a local pig farm that collected waste residues for animal feed has grown into a major player in the processing of organic waste.
Today, Semler is part of Renewi Organics, an international waste processing company with a mission to give waste a second life by recycling and reusing it as much as possible. With a recycling rate of 63%, Renewi has already managed to repurpose millions of tons of waste. At the locations in Son, Amsterdam and Lelystad, waste consisting of out-of-date products (ODP), industrial rejects, recall products and SWILL are processed. They use plastic 2-wheel mini containers and pallet boxes to collect these flows.

Renewi distinguishes itself by converting waste into valuable raw materials and energy, with the aim of giving 90% of all the waste it processes a new destination.
At the Son site, Renewi uses various Smicon solutions, including the SP600, SMIMO160, windshifter and cyclone. This allows them to process up to 25 tons of waste per hour and ultimately leaves them with only 4% residual waste. The waste recycling industry is constantly changing, with increasingly strict laws and regulations. Olaf sees changes in the waste streams in particular. “Supermarkets are striving to reduce food waste, which is reducing these waste streams. At the same time, we are seeing an increase in restaurant waste (SWILL), because they are increasingly being separated. Smicon helps us to respond flexibly to these trends.”
